Black Honey• this movie is a black comedy criticizing the reality of the Egyptian

community, where Egyptian citizens are treated badly in their own country on the contrary of the tourists who is just visiting Egypt. This movie is explaining the facts with all its advantages and disadvantages. The story is about an Egyptian young man who lived most of his life in America, and when he decided to go back to his country after almost twenty years for business and because of the excitement, he left his American passport taking only the Egyptian one believing that he does not need it in his home country. However, from the moment he entered the country using this passport, he was shocked from the bad treatment and the insult each time he cherished that he is an Egyptian, also he was shocked of the bad situation of his country.

• Bad treatment accompanied him everywhere in the airport by security, hotels and police station. Therefore, he decided to bring his American passport to get the tourists good treatment.

• However, although all these events, he spent a few days with his childhood Egyptian friend and his poor family and that made him see and feel “the kindness of people, satisfaction and the warmth of family.”
